Pastor James Heyward King, age 78, fought a good fight, he has finished his course. He kept the faith: henceforth there is laid up for him a crown of righteousness, which the Lord, the righteous judge, gave him on Thursday, October 16, 2025. He is survived by his beloved wife, Peggy Pollard King; his devoted children, D. Sherrell King, James H. King II, Daphne David (Eric), Harry W. Howard (Wendy), and April Howard Watkins (Robert); 10 cherished grandchildren, Savanna Jones, Trey Jones, Mina Chaison (Garrett), Emma King, Noah David, Joshua David, Christopher Watkins, Nicholas Watkins (Kayla), Logan Watkins and Torrence Howard; and 3 great-grandchildren. He also leaves behind his brother, Robert H. King (Faye) and sister, Regina King Etheridge (Earl).
He has joined his Lord and Savior; his parents, Robert H. King and Naomi G. King; his daughter, Sharonda A. King; and his wife of 18 years, Geraldine “Gerri” M. King.
James graduated from Biloxi High School in 1965 and was a minister of the gospel of Jesus Christ for nearly 60 years. He faithfully served churches in Lucedale, New Hebron and Hattiesburg, Mississippi and retired in July 2025 from being the pastor of D’Iberville Christian Assembly, after 44 years of dedicated service. James also served as the chaplain for the City of D’Iberville, MS. He performed countless weddings, funerals, hospital visits and dedications, always eager to serve his community. He was unequivocally loyal to the spreading the Word of Jesus Christ and being available to all who were in need. He greatly valued time spent with family and fellow pastors. He was a beautiful pianist, loved to fish and attend local football games, especially with his grandchildren. His unwavering dedication to the ministry of Jesus Christ made an everlasting impact on more lives than we can imagine.
